Houston Mourns as Iconic Newsman Dave Ward Passes Away at 86
BREAKING: Houston is in mourning following the passing of legendary news anchor Dave Ward, who died at the age of 86. His death was confirmed earlier today, marking the end of an era for local journalism after more than 50 years on the air in Houston.
Ward’s illustrious career began in the early 1970s at ABC13, where he became a trusted figure in homes across the city. Known for his warm demeanor and commitment to community reporting, Ward’s influence extended beyond the newsroom, shaping how news was delivered in Texas.
His contributions to journalism were profound, and he won numerous awards throughout his career, including several Emmys. Ward’s storytelling ability captivated audiences, making him a beloved figure in the city. He covered countless significant events, from hurricanes to political elections, and was a fixture at community events.
“Dave was not just a news anchor; he was a part of our lives,” said ABC13 colleagues in a heartfelt tribute. His passing is a significant loss for the Houston community and the journalism landscape.
As tributes pour in from fans, colleagues, and public figures, many are sharing their memories of Ward on social media, highlighting his impact on their lives. His legacy will continue through those he inspired, and the essence of his reporting will be remembered for generations to come.
Authorities are expected to announce memorial plans in the coming days. As Houston reflects on the life of this iconic newsman, many will be watching for ways to honor his contributions to the community he served so faithfully.
